They Attend Petes Funeral

Pete had an ordinary funeral, nothing ostentatious or showy. Two straight backed strangers appeared in his small Iowa church. They were dressed in Air Force uniforms. They hugged each other for a long time. Another soldier gone, one said. Our brother said the other. These three had been the only survivors of C Company. In the middle of a jungle swamp in Viet Nam in 1970. From his catbird seat Pete Lansford watched. He was grinning at them so hard that Jim looked up. Pete gave him a high five, but neither Jim or Joe could see him. Thank you for letting me watch my funeral he told the angel.
